Progress Technology Rear Sway Bars for a 2008-2010 Mitsubishi Lancer.
Progress Tech sway bars dramatically improve handling. How? They minimize the traction-robbing body "lean" that rolls part of the outside tires off the pavement. Our Sport-tuned Sway Bars replace smaller OEM sway bars and rubber bushings with larger diameter alloy steel bars and harder polyurethane bushings. Adding more "roll stiffness" means less body "lean" or "sway" and the tires remain flatter and better-connected to the pavement. The larger and more stable tire contact patches result in more grip, control and added driver confidence. Chassis tuning with larger and/or adjustable sway bars is a simple and effective method to improve chassis balance and minimize the excessive understeer (or plowing) so common in our modern vehicles. Progress Tech Sway Bars are cold-formed in-house using our precision CNC bending equipment. Both laser-cut and CNC-machined sway bar ends are MIG-welded in place using precise fixtures for an exact fit.
